Below are a couple of straightforward steps for householders to adhere to in order to maintain the condition of their sewage system.
Regular Inspection and Pumping
Typically, a residential sewage tank needs to be professionally examined on a regular basis, typically every 3 to 5 years by experienced technicians. During this inspection, the expert inspectors can check for leaks, inspect the top and base of your tank, evaluate the scum and sludge layers in your tank, and execute professional maintenance of your tank.
Efficient Use Of Water
The lower the amount of water in a home equates to less water entering the septic tank. Restroom usage accounts for about 25-30% of water use within the residential property. The most effective method to decrease water usage in the toilet is by replacing current fixtures with low-flow ones, which use less gallons of water per flushing.
High Efficiency Shower Heads
Water used when showering additionally directed into the septic tank. To minimize this, the smart choice involves using low-flow shower appliances, crafted to decrease water use.
Proper Disposal of Waste
Many people exhibit the unfortunate practice of dealing with the toilet as if it were a trash can. However, engaging in this conduct inevitably sewage system obstructions. So, householders must ensure that everyone in the household disposes of refuse appropriately and doesn't flush it down the toilet.
Seasonal Septic System Care Advice
As crucial as maintaining the sewage system annually, it is equally vital to provide season-specific maintenance to the sewage tank system. Listed are a few tips for seasonal maintenance across the seasonal changes:
Fall (Autumn)
Ensuring proper maintenance of the sewage system plays a significant role in preparing for the harsh cold winter weather.
- Consider pumping the sewage tank before winter arrives, as doing so becomes hard in the winter months.
- During the fall season, restrict the use of lawn mowers within the vicinity of the sewage tank, while avoid using automobiles in this area at all costs.
- Additionally, make sure to shield the treatment soil from freezing.
Winter
Caring for septic systems throughout the winter might be substantial hurdles, particularly in freezing weather. That's why, it's wise to start preparing for cold weather ahead of time, typically in autumn.
The most important care you can offer your septic tank system during winter involves periodically examining the commonly affected zones where septic systems might freeze, with the goal of avoiding this potential issue. These areas include:
- The conduit emanating from the tank in your residence
- The piping that goes to the area designated for soil treatment
- The section for soil treatment
- And the septic tank itself
Spring
- Taking care of your septic system during spring involves the following steps:
- When the sun is out and the snow is thawing, it's a suitable opportunity to schedule a professional septic inspection. This inspection ensures the health of your septic tank.
- Springtime offers an excellent opportunity to replace your filter. The filter might have become clogged during the winter months, potentially causing septic system issues.
- Spring is an opportune moment to schedule a tank maintenance. This helps maintain the efficiency of your septic tank.
Summer
Proper septic system maintenance for the summer season involves the following steps:
- Warm weather in the summer can intensify the odor from your septic tank, so homeowners should be prepared to seek professional septic tank services during the summer months.
- The use of water tends to increase during the summer, causing more water entering the septic tank. To mitigate this, consider using high-efficiency toilets that are more water-efficient.

QUESTION: What is the recommended frequency for septic tank pumping?
ANSWER:Various factors contribute to this, but usually, septic tanks should be pumped every every three to five years.
QUESTION:What measures can I take to safeguard my septic tank from potential system failure?
ANSWER: To ensure the longevity of your septic tank, it's important to carry out regular schedule professional septic tank inspections.
QUESTION: Which septic tank system is the most excellent?
ANSWER: In reality, every septic tank variety is capable as long as proper maintenance is performed. Yet, before placing a septic system, there are certain aspects to consider. These factors include climate conditions, the size of the property, and more.
QUESTION:What's the typical duration for septic tank installation?
ANSWER: Several variables influence the timeframe required for septic tank installation. These factors include weather conditions, the size of the septic tank, the chosen septic tank system, and more. Nevertheless, all things considered, the installation process typically shouldn't take longer than 1-2 weeks.
